Description: GREENGROVE HEAD START is a Five Star Center License in FAIRMONT NC, with a maximum capacity of 84 children. This child care center helps with children in the age range of 2 through 5. The provider does not participate in a subsidized child care program.

Date Type Violations Rule
2026-05-05 Unannounced Inspection Yes
2026-05-05 Violation 1048 .1102(c)
All staff did not successfully complete certification in First Aid appropriate to the age of children in care. Verification of staff completion of First Aid training from an approved training organization was not in the staff file. Documentation was not on file for two staff members.
2026-05-05 Violation 1049 .1102(d)
All staff did not successfully complete certification in CPR training appropriate to the age of the children in care. Verification of staff completion of the CPR course from an approved training organization was not in the staff file. Documentation was not on file for one staff member.
2025-12-10 Unannounced Inspection Yes
2025-12-10 Violation 428 GS 110-91(12); .0508(a)
A current activity plan was not posted for each group of children for reference. In space #3, the activity plan was dated Oct. 27 - Oct. 31.
2025-12-10 Violation 840 .2820(b)
All corrosive agents, pesticides, bleaches, detergents, cleansers, polishes, any product which is under pressure in an aerosol dispenser, and any substance which may be hazardous to a child if ingested, inhaled, or handled were not stored in a locked room or cabinet. In space #8, 5 cans of disinfectant spray, 1 bottle of cleaner, and 2 containers of cleaning wipes were located in an unlocked cabinet over the sink. This was corrected by locking the cabinet.
2025-12-10 Violation 858 .0604(q)
Plastic bags, materials that could be torn apart and toy parts small enough to be swallowed were accessible to children under three years of age. In space #4, plastic bags were located in unlocked drawers in the changing table. This was corrected by removing the plastic bags out of the drawer and placing them out of reach of the children.
2025-12-10 Violation 1899 .1103(b)
Health and safety training topics were not included as part of on-going training within five years of completing the previous health and safety training topics. Four staff members had not completed the required Recognizing and Responding to Suspicions of Maltreatment training within at least five years of taking the previous training.
2025-02-04 Unannounced Inspection No
2025-01-14 Unannounced Inspection No 0125-059L
2024-12-19 Unannounced Inspection Yes
2024-12-19 Violation 1035 .0701(a)
Child care providers, including the director, uncompensated providers, substitute providers, and volunteers did not have the required Emergency Information Form on file on or before the first day of work, which included all the required information and/or the information on the form was not updated as changes occur and at least annually. One staff member's emergency information had not been updated at least annually. This was corrected by the staff member updating a new form and placing it on file at the center.
2024-10-09 Unannounced Inspection No
2024-04-11 Unannounced Inspection Yes 0424-140A
2024-04-11 Violation 902 G.S. 110-91(10)
Each child was not attended to in a nurturing and appropriate manner, or in keeping with the child's developmental needs. A staff member popped a two-year-old child on the top of their hand with their open hand three times.
